如何使用WebStorm中的内置Web服务器打开/调试当前文件?

时间:2013-04-29 23:24:55

标签: javascript debugging webstorm

有没有办法创建一个运行配置,使用WebStorm内置Web服务器(http://localhost:63342/)在浏览器中打开正在编辑的文件并开始调试?

参考:http://blog.jetbrains.com/webstorm/2013/03/built-in-server-in-webstorm-6/

2 个答案:

答案 0 :(得分:9)

您不需要运行配置,但默认就地部署:

server

请注意,服务器配置名称( LOCAL )为粗体,这意味着它是默认设置(可以通过右键菜单设置或an icon )。

配置映射,如下所示:

mappings

其中项目是项目的名称。

现在您可以使用View | Preview file in Alt + F2 )并根据需要启用Live Edit


请注意,它对预览很有用,不会启动JavaScript调试。要调试页面上的脚本,请右键单击该文件,然后使用Run或文件上下文菜单中的调试操作或相应的键盘快捷键:

Debug

答案 1 :(得分:2)

另一个不需要为每个项目设置安装的解决方案是创建一个外部工具,该工具将使用正确的路径加载您的首选浏览器。以下是有关如何使用chrome进行设置的示例:

external tools setup

程序:

C:\Program Files (x86)\Google\Chrome\Application\chrome.exe

参数(如果文件名中包含空格,请不要忘记引号):

"http://localhost:63342/$ProjectName$/$FilePathRelativeToProjectRoot$"

工作目录:

C:\Program Files (x86)\Google\Chrome\Application\chrome.exe

一旦你设置了它,它将适用于任何项目。确保将程序路径和工作目录调整到安装Chrome浏览器的路径。